Njoki Njehu on the WSF 2011 in Africa
Among the founders of the African Social Forum, Njoki Njehu is a reknown Kenian activist, representing the Daughters of Mumbi resource center. She participated to the Porto Alegre 10years Seminar of the World Social Forum and reflects on the WSF returning to Africa in 2011.
